1978 Citroen CX vs. 1978 Skoda L
To start off, both 1978 Citroen CX and 1978 Skoda L were released in the same year (1978).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 2,499 cc (4 cylinders), 1978 Citroen CX is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1978 Citroen CX (74 HP @ 4250 RPM) has 30 more horse power than 1978 Skoda L. (44 HP @ 4800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1978 Citroen CX should accelerate faster than 1978 Skoda L.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1978 Citroen CX weights approximately 545 kg more than 1978 Skoda L.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 1978 Citroen CX (149 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 75 more torque (in Nm) than 1978 Skoda L. (74 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1978 Citroen CX will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1978 Skoda L.
Compare all specifications:
1978 Citroen CX | 1978 Skoda L | |
Make | Citroen | Skoda |
Model | CX | L |
Year Released | 1978 | 1978 |
Engine Position | Front | Rear |
Engine Size | 2499 cc | 1046 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 74 HP | 44 HP |
Engine RPM | 4250 RPM | 4800 RPM |
Torque | 149 Nm | 74 Nm |
Torque RPM | 2000 RPM | 3000 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 93.1 mm | 68.1 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 92 mm | 72 mm |
Fuel Type | Diesel | Gasoline |
Number of Doors | 5 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1370 kg | 825 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4670 mm | 4170 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1770 mm | 1600 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1370 mm | 1410 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2850 mm | 2410 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 80 L | 38 L |
